NYSP charge man for fake inspection sticker in Homer

NYSP charge man for fake inspection sticker in Homer

Troopers say the sticker on the left is fraudulent, and the one on the right is real. Photo: Saga Communications/NYSP


HOMER, NY (607NewsNow) – A Syracuse man is facing charges in Homer.

On August 6, State Police pulled a vehicle over on Interstate-81 around 11:55 a.m. for vehicle and traffic violations.

During the stop, troopers allegedly discovered that the driver, 32-year-old Otis Tillie, had a revoked license and a forged inspection sticker. Tillie was arrested and charged with having a forged inspection certificate and aggravated unlicensed operation, both misdemeanors.

Tillie’s vehicle was impounded.
